I applied through a staffing agency.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Capgemini (Bengaluru) in Nov 2017
Interview
Day 1: There was iCompass Test that includes (1) Aptitude Test (MCQ) (2) English Essay (3) Basic Computer Science Test (MCQ)
Day 2: Group Discussion on a certain topic as per the choice of the recruiter
Day 3: Technical Round of Test: Spring, Hibernate, Java SE & Java EE - MCQ and Coding
Day 4: Versant Round
Day 5: HR Round
